Exploring the Name Shamgar and Spiritual Agency

The chapter examines the origins and meaning of the name Shamgar, drawing connections to 'garlic' and 'Shakespeare' based on the suffix 'gar.' It discusses the distinction between spirits and ideas in terms of agency, emphasizing how spiritual forces influence human actions through the presentation of ideas. Additionally, it delves into the transition from the Old Testament to the New Testament, focusing on the prophetic references to Pentecost and the concept of the Holy Spirit in relation to baptism and theosis.
